WebMints are items introduced in Generation VIII. Using a Mint on a Pokémon changes its boosted and hindered stat to its namesake Nature, but keeps its actual Nature unchanged. This means that Mints cannot be used to affect other stats Natures determine, such as the Pokémon's preferred and disliked flavor and Toxel's evolution. WebFrom Bulbapedia, the community-driven Pokémon encyclopedia. Poké Beans (Japanese: ポケマメ Poké Bean) are a food introduced in Generation VII that is usually fed to Pokémon. They also have other uses, such as roasting to make coffee. The beans can sprout into Poké Beanstalks, which drop more beans, like on Poké Pelago 's Isle Abeens.
